Abstract
A serial of quality control (QC) procedures were performed on a gauge-based global daily precipitation dataset from the Global Telecommunication System (GTS) for the period 1998-2009. A new global precipitation dataset was constructed after the control procedures. The new dataset was evaluated using CMAP and GPCP precipitation products. The results show that the frequency and spatial distribution of monthly precipitation in the new dataset well agree with those in CMAP and GPCP. The global mean correlation coefficient between gauge precipitation and CMAP/GPCP precipitation increased from 0.24 before QC to 0.70 after QC, accordingly, and the root mean square error decreased form 12 mm/d to 1 mm/d. The interannual variability of monthly precipitation in the new dataset is consistent with that of the CMAP/GPCP in Asia; and the seasonal variability of precipitation in different regions over the world coincides with those of CMAP/GPCP quite well.关键词
